Understanding Powder Coating: Process, Benefits, and Industry Standards

Powder coating has emerged as one of the most popular surface treatment methods for industrial products in 2026. Unlike traditional liquid painting, powder coating applies a dry powder electrostatically to metal surfaces, which is then cured under heat to form a hard, protective layer. This process creates a finish that is significantly more durable than conventional paint while offering environmental advantages that align with modern sustainability requirements.

For manufacturers considering powder coating finish options, understanding the technical process is essential. The powder consists of resin and pigment particles that are electrostatically charged during application. Once sprayed onto the product, items are heated in an oven, causing the powder to melt and flow into a uniform coating. The result is a tough layer resistant to chipping, scratching, fading, and corrosion—qualities that make it ideal for industrial products like bench vises, metal furniture, automotive parts, and architectural components.

The environmental benefits of powder coating cannot be overstated. Traditional liquid coatings release volatile organic compounds (VOCs) during application and curing, contributing to air pollution and requiring expensive ventilation systems. Powder coating, by contrast, produces nearly zero VOC emissions, making it compliant with increasingly strict environmental regulations in North America, Europe, and other major export markets.

Another significant advantage is material efficiency. Industry data shows that powder coating achieves material recovery rates of 90-95% through overspray collection and reuse systems. This contrasts sharply with liquid painting, where significant material is lost to evaporation and waste. For high-volume manufacturers, this efficiency translates directly into cost savings and reduced environmental impact.

However, powder coating is not without limitations. The process requires specialized equipment including electrostatic spray guns and curing ovens, representing a significant initial investment. Additionally, achieving uniform coverage on complex geometries or intricate shapes can be challenging, requiring skilled operators and careful process control. Heat-sensitive materials cannot be powder coated due to the high curing temperatures required (typically 180-200°C).

For custom color coating requests, manufacturers should understand that color matching requires careful formulation. Powder coatings use specialized pigments, and achieving exact color matches may require custom batching, which affects lead times and minimum order quantities. Industry experts recommend working closely with powder suppliers to develop color standards and approve samples before full production runs.

Powder Coating vs. Liquid Painting: An Objective Comparison

When evaluating surface treatment options, manufacturers must weigh the trade-offs between powder coating and traditional liquid painting. Neither approach is universally superior—the optimal choice depends on product requirements, production volume, budget constraints, and target market expectations. This section provides a neutral, data-driven comparison to help Southeast Asian exporters make informed decisions.

Durability and Performance: Powder coating generally provides superior durability compared to liquid painting. The cured powder forms a thicker, more uniform layer that resists chipping, scratching, and corrosion. This makes it particularly suitable for products exposed to harsh conditions, such as outdoor equipment, automotive components, and industrial tools. Liquid paints, while improving in quality, typically require multiple coats and clear topcoats to achieve comparable protection.

Powder Coating vs. Liquid Painting: Feature Comparison

FeaturePowder CoatingLiquid Painting
DurabilitySuperior - thick, hard finish resistant to chipping and scratchingGood - requires multiple coats and clear topcoat for similar protection
Environmental ImpactNearly zero VOC emissions, 90-95% material recoveryHigher VOC emissions, significant material waste
Initial Equipment CostHigher - requires electrostatic spray guns and curing ovensLower - simpler application equipment
Color FlexibilityLimited - custom colors require batching, slower color changesExcellent - rapid color changes, wider color range
Application SpeedFaster for high-volume, single-color productionFaster for low-volume, multi-color jobs
Substrate CompatibilityMetal only, heat-resistant materialsMetal, plastic, wood, heat-sensitive materials
Finish Thickness ControlMore difficult - tends to apply thick layersEasier - precise thickness control possible
Repair and Touch-upDifficult - requires complete recoatingEasier - localized repair possible
Source: Industry analysis from Products Finishing, Crest Coating, and Hermetachem reports [2][3][5]

Cost Considerations: The cost equation favors powder coating for high-volume production runs. While initial equipment investment is higher, the superior material efficiency (90-95% recovery vs. 50-70% for liquid paint) and reduced waste disposal costs often result in lower per-unit costs at scale. For small-batch or custom orders, liquid painting may be more economical due to lower setup costs and faster color changeover.

Environmental Compliance: This is where powder coating holds a decisive advantage. With environmental regulations tightening globally—particularly in the EU and North America—powder coating's near-zero VOC emissions provide a significant compliance advantage. Manufacturers exporting to regulated markets may find powder coating simplifies certification processes and reduces regulatory risk.

Expert Rodger Talbert, writing in Products Finishing magazine, offers practical guidance: "If you can go with powder, you probably should go with powder" for products without heat-sensitive components. He notes that powder coating is better for cost and environmental compliance, while liquid painting excels at rapid color changes and complex geometries [3].

Custom Color Coating: Lead Time and Capability Considerations

Custom color matching is one of the most requested capabilities for powder coating, but it introduces complexity in production planning, inventory management, and buyer communication. This section provides practical guidance on lead time expectations, minimum order quantities, and best practices for managing custom color orders.

Color Matching Process: Achieving accurate custom colors requires iterative sampling and approval. Powder coating pigments behave differently than liquid paint pigments, and color appearance can vary based on substrate, coating thickness, and curing conditions. Manufacturers should establish a clear sampling protocol:

  1. Request Pantone or RAL color references from buyers
  2. Produce lab-scale samples for initial approval
  3. Create production-scale samples for final validation
  4. Document approved color standards for future reference
  5. Retain sample panels for quality control comparison

Lead Time Implications: Custom color orders inherently require longer lead times than standard colors. Industry feedback suggests:

  • Standard colors (black, white, common RAL colors): 7-14 days production lead time
  • Custom colors with existing formula: 14-21 days (includes sample approval)
  • New custom color development: 21-35 days (includes formulation, sampling, approval)

These timelines assume normal production capacity. Rush orders may be possible with premium pricing, but quality risks increase with compressed schedules. Manufacturers should communicate realistic timelines upfront and build buffer time for sample approval iterations.

Minimum Order Quantities: Custom powder coating colors typically require minimum batch sizes due to powder production economics. Common MOQs range from 50-100 kg of powder, which may translate to 200-500 units depending on product size and coating thickness. For smaller orders, manufacturers may need to:

  • Charge custom color setup fees
  • Combine orders from multiple buyers
  • Use closest available standard color
  • Require buyer to purchase and retain excess powder inventory

Quality Control for Custom Colors: Consistency across production batches is critical for custom colors. Manufacturers should implement:

  • Spectrophotometer color measurement for objective validation
  • Standardized curing parameters (temperature, time)
  • Retained sample panels for each approved color
  • First-article inspection for each production run
  • Documentation of powder batch numbers and curing records

Durability and Maintenance: What Buyers Need to Know

Durability is the primary selling point of powder coating, but buyers have varying expectations based on application environment and product usage. Clear communication about durability characteristics and maintenance requirements helps set appropriate expectations and reduces post-sale disputes.

Durability Characteristics: Properly applied powder coating provides:

  • Scratch resistance: Superior to most liquid paints due to thicker, harder finish
  • Corrosion resistance: Excellent when combined with proper surface preparation and primer
  • UV resistance: Varies by resin type—polyester and hybrid resins offer good outdoor durability
  • Chemical resistance: Good resistance to solvents, oils, and mild chemicals
  • Impact resistance: Thick coating provides cushioning against minor impacts

However, powder coating is not indestructible. Severe impacts can chip the coating, and prolonged UV exposure can cause fading in some colors. Buyers should understand these limitations.

Surface Preparation Critical Success Factor: Industry experts consistently emphasize that powder coating durability depends fundamentally on surface preparation. Poor preparation leads to premature failure regardless of powder quality. Key preparation steps include:

  1. Degreasing: Remove oils, dirt, and contaminants
  2. Abrasive blasting: Create surface profile for mechanical adhesion
  3. Chemical treatment: Apply conversion coating (phosphate, chromate) for corrosion resistance
  4. Drying: Ensure complete moisture removal before powder application

Manufacturers should document and communicate their surface preparation processes to buyers. Photos or videos of preparation stages serve as powerful trust signals.

Maintenance Recommendations: Powder coated products require minimal maintenance but benefit from:

  • Regular cleaning with mild soap and water
  • Avoiding abrasive cleaners that can scratch the finish
  • Prompt repair of chips to prevent corrosion spread
  • Periodic inspection for wear in high-friction areas

Providing maintenance guidelines with products demonstrates professionalism and helps buyers maximize product lifespan.

Failure Analysis: When powder coating failures occur, common root causes include:

  • Inadequate surface preparation (most common)
  • Improper curing (under-cured or over-cured)
  • Contamination during application
  • Incorrect powder selection for application environment
  • Substrate incompatibility

Understanding failure modes helps manufacturers improve processes and respond effectively to quality claims.

Configuration Decision Guide: Choosing the Right Surface Treatment for Your Products

There is no universally optimal surface treatment configuration—only the best fit for your specific products, production capabilities, and target markets. This decision guide helps manufacturers evaluate powder coating against alternatives based on objective criteria.

Choose Powder Coating When:

  • Products are metal and heat-resistant (can withstand 180-200°C curing)
  • High-volume production with limited color changes
  • Target markets have strict environmental regulations (EU, North America)
  • Durability and corrosion resistance are primary buyer requirements
  • You can invest in proper equipment and operator training
  • Material efficiency and waste reduction are priorities

Choose Liquid Painting When:

  • Products include heat-sensitive materials (plastic, wood, assemblies)
  • Frequent color changes or custom colors with low MOQs
  • Complex geometries requiring thin, precise coating
  • Lower initial equipment investment is necessary
  • Touch-up and repair capability is important
  • Rapid prototyping and short lead times are critical

Surface Treatment Configuration Comparison: Key Decision Factors

Decision FactorPowder CoatingLiquid PaintingBest For
Production VolumeHigh volume, long runsLow to medium volume, flexible batch sizesPowder: mass production; Liquid: custom/small batch
Color FlexibilityLimited, slower changesExcellent, rapid changesLiquid for frequent color changes
Environmental ComplianceNear-zero VOC, easy complianceHigher VOC, requires controlsPowder for regulated markets
Initial InvestmentHigh ($50,000-$200,000+)Low to medium ($10,000-$50,000)Liquid for budget-constrained startups
Per-Unit Cost (High Volume)Lower due to material efficiencyHigher due to wastePowder for cost-competitive high volume
Durability RequirementsSuperior for harsh environmentsGood with proper topcoatsPowder for outdoor/industrial use
Substrate TypesMetal only, heat-resistantMetal, plastic, wood, compositesLiquid for mixed materials
Lead Time (Custom Color)14-35 days with sampling7-14 days, faster approvalLiquid for urgent custom orders
Note: Cost estimates vary by region and scale. Consult local equipment suppliers for accurate quotes.
